The ubiquity of technology has transformed education, making online learning part of the “new norm.” Over the past few years, online enrollments in higher education have continued to grow in the US. Online enrollments are being driven by the growing number of students who are seeking flexible formats for courses, certificates, and degree programs to support career placement, advancement, and transition as well as to pursue advanced studies. Increasingly, students enrolled in on-campus programs are also registering for hybrid to fully online courses throughout their enrollment.
